After the Wedding

by jenray @ Thursday, Jul. 03, 2008 - 18:59:06

Hi to everybody....sat and watched a Danish film last night on BBC4 called 'After the Wedding' starring Mads Mikkelsen and Rolf Laarson....it was slightly difficult to watch as it was a hand held camera and made the film a bit jumpy here and there, but, on the whole, it was a good story that gradually unfolded to become much more complex than it originally appeared...The acting was very good...particularly Rolf Laarson, who played a billionaire. I don't want to spoil the story by telling you the plot concerning him, because to do so would ruin the film. I don't like spoilers when I'm telling you about a film because I can see no point in recommending one and then telling you what the film was all about...makes it rather pointless bothering to watch it if you already know what's going to happen...
Also, the week before I saw another Danish film called 'Open Heart' again with Mads Mikkelsen. It was a completely different story about an accident that has a devastating effect on all the lives of the people involved in it, and was well paced and well acted again...I can recommend this one as well...Mikkelsen reminds me a bit of Vigo Mortensen in that he doesn't seem to act much but is a very powerful presence nonetheless...
Hope you get a chance to see both...good to see well acted European films being shown on BBC4...
